- 420 名前:nobodyさん [2006/05/20(土) 11:06:26 ID:FxboaxWW]
- PEAR::DBで、
$res = $db->query($sql); if (DB::isError($res) … と記述して、クエリの実行時エラーを検出しようとしているのですが、 例えば、$sqlに存在しないテーブルへの参照クエリを設定して実行しても、 $resにはDB_Resultが返されます。 $res->fetchRow()するとDB_Errorが返ってきます。 var_dump($res)すると、$resに格納されているDB_Resultの['result']に DB_Errorが格納されています。 これって仕様なのでしょうか? PHP 5.1.2 MySQL 5.0.19
|

|